Trait opencv::dnn::prelude::ModelTrait   
source · pub trait ModelTrait: ModelTraitConst {
    // Required method
    fn as_raw_mut_Model(&mut self) -> *mut c_void;
    // Provided methods
    fn set_input_size(&mut self, size: Size) -> Result<Model> { ... }
    fn set_input_size_1(&mut self, width: i32, height: i32) -> Result<Model> { ... }
    fn set_input_mean(&mut self, mean: Scalar) -> Result<Model> { ... }
    fn set_input_scale(&mut self, scale: f64) -> Result<Model> { ... }
    fn set_input_crop(&mut self, crop: bool) -> Result<Model> { ... }
    fn set_input_swap_rb(&mut self, swap_rb: bool) -> Result<Model> { ... }
    fn set_input_params(
        &mut self,
        scale: f64,
        size: Size,
        mean: Scalar,
        swap_rb: bool,
        crop: bool
    ) -> Result<()> { ... }
    fn set_preferable_backend(&mut self, backend_id: Backend) -> Result<Model> { ... }
    fn set_preferable_target(&mut self, target_id: Target) -> Result<Model> { ... }
    fn get_network__1(&mut self) -> Result<Net> { ... }
}Expand description
Mutable methods for crate::dnn::Model
Required Methods§
fn as_raw_mut_Model(&mut self) -> *mut c_void
Provided Methods§
sourcefn set_input_size(&mut self, size: Size) -> Result<Model>
 
fn set_input_size(&mut self, size: Size) -> Result<Model>
Set input size for frame.
Parameters
- size: New input size.
 
Note: If shape of the new blob less than 0, then frame size not change.
sourcefn set_input_size_1(&mut self, width: i32, height: i32) -> Result<Model>
 
fn set_input_size_1(&mut self, width: i32, height: i32) -> Result<Model>
Set input size for frame.
Parameters
- size: New input size.
 
Note: If shape of the new blob less than 0, then frame size not change.
Overloaded parameters
- width: New input width.
 - height: New input height.
 
sourcefn set_input_mean(&mut self, mean: Scalar) -> Result<Model>
 
fn set_input_mean(&mut self, mean: Scalar) -> Result<Model>
Set mean value for frame.
Parameters
- mean: Scalar with mean values which are subtracted from channels.

sourcefn set_input_crop(&mut self, crop: bool) -> Result<Model>
 
fn set_input_crop(&mut self, crop: bool) -> Result<Model>
Set flag crop for frame.
Parameters
- crop: Flag which indicates whether image will be cropped after resize or not.
 
sourcefn set_input_swap_rb(&mut self, swap_rb: bool) -> Result<Model>
 
fn set_input_swap_rb(&mut self, swap_rb: bool) -> Result<Model>
Set flag swapRB for frame.
Parameters
- swapRB: Flag which indicates that swap first and last channels.
 
sourcefn set_input_params(
    &mut self,
    scale: f64,
    size: Size,
    mean: Scalar,
    swap_rb: bool,
    crop: bool
) -> Result<()>
 
fn set_input_params( &mut self, scale: f64, size: Size, mean: Scalar, swap_rb: bool, crop: bool ) -> Result<()>
Set preprocessing parameters for frame.
Parameters
- size: New input size.
 - mean: Scalar with mean values which are subtracted from channels.
 - scale: Multiplier for frame values.
 - swapRB: Flag which indicates that swap first and last channels.
 - crop: Flag which indicates whether image will be cropped after resize or not. blob(n, c, y, x) = scale * resize( frame(y, x, c) ) - mean(c) )
 
C++ default parameters
- scale: 1.0
 - size: Size()
 - mean: Scalar()
 - swap_rb: false
 - crop: false
